What sets the Nyquist limit in Doppler color imaging?

Explanation:
In Doppler color imaging, the Nyquist limit is set by half the pulse repetition frequency. This is because you’re sampling Doppler shifts at a rate determined by the PRF, and the highest frequency you can accurately represent without aliasing is half of that sampling rate. If the actual Doppler shift from blood flow exceeds this limit, the displayed velocity can wrap around and appear misleading or in the opposite direction. So increasing the PRF raises the Nyquist limit and reduces aliasing, while decreasing it lowers the limit and makes aliasing more likely. Frame rate affects how many color frames you get per second and relates to temporal resolution, but it does not establish the maximum Doppler frequency you can correctly sample. The Doppler frequency is the shift you’re trying to measure, not the limit itself. Wall filter, meanwhile, helps suppress tissue motion and clutter but does not determine the Nyquist limit.
